Tata Steel Continues to Negotiate Joint Venture Partnership for U.K. Strip Business
10/28/2016 - The ouster of Cyrus Mistry as chairman of Tata Group's holding company has renewed questions over the fate of Tata Steel's European arm. Nevertheless, the company is continuing to pursue a merger of its U.K strip business and a separate sale of its specialty steel business there, the company said on Friday.
"The talks with thyssenkrupp AG for a potential joint venture of its European steel business are currently ongoing and progressing," the company said in a statement. "Tata Steel would also like to reaffirm that it is currently pursuing a separate process for the potential sale of the South Yorkshire-based Specialty Steels business," it added.
The company had said as much during a closed-door briefing with analysts on Thursday, according to the Reuters news service.
